Transaction 7042156f3dedf167b18f7e39085d35f04e11ff8a09da091e12da3ebe2f451007
1 Input
2 Outputs
- 7042156f3dedf167b18f7e39085d35f04e11ff8a09da091e12da3ebe2f451007:0
- 7042156f3dedf167b18f7e39085d35f04e11ff8a09da091e12da3ebe2f451007:1
value 7198410
address 1LQPyQQZxW58hKtx8UxKnfN2948Kk7bC8y
value 20075636
address 398inPYcmLMcsGm1YSHTDypJ3Ux4WWH47m